Interest of a Skin Transilluminator (Such as the VeinViewer®Vision Device) for Peripheral Venous Catheter Placement in the Obese Patient

NCT02894073 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 2

Last updated 2018-08-21

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

Placement of a peripheral venous catheter (PVC) is the most common invasive procedure in anaesthesia and perhaps even in the field of medicine as a whole.
